    Eject CD from Mac
    How do I eject a CD?
    I just recorded a song that I wrote on a CD. Then, I put CD in my computer to add it to ITunes, which I have done before. This time, ITunes did not pop up on the screen and I cannot eject the CD. Will you please tell me how I can eject it? I tried already tried the eject disk under ITunes Controls.

    Pull the CD or DVD to The trash or depress the Eject key on the keyboard it is a piromid over a _ , usuall found on laptops as the upper right most key or on apple desktop keyboards as the upper right most key excluding the numeric key pad.

    Thank you much! I didn't even know that key was on my keyboard and that did the trick. Also, now I discovered that I did not finalize my CD, so the computer did not recognize it in that form. All is correct now, thanks to you.

    Pull the files to the CD then pull the CD to the trash this will burn, finalize and eject the CD. For music use iTunes.
